Luv Creami

I LOVE Creami's I have the five choice machine that I've had for 2 years and when I saw the seven recipe one at Sam's on sale I splurged and bought it. I love being able to make Dole Whips in a variety of flavors as I buy the Dole whip powder online. I also love making a guacamole type creami in the summer it is so refreshing I just cut up three to four avocados depending on the size and the little cubes, then I add a couple of tablespoons of sour cream and then I'll add some salsa. We blend it on the soft ice cream speed and after we've spun it we will add some fresh cilantro and do it on a remix. There's a Facebook page that is from a website called tasty traveler and there must be hundreds of different ideas and recipes posted there. And for those of you who have wear the gear has broken or shared itself major reason that happens is one that there was too much water base in the creamy container, or that the chunks of fruit etc were too large, that even though below the line if the mixture is slanted that can cause the blades to shave also when they say that it your freezer should be it seven below or seven degrees, all the people on the Facebook page and I will tell you that get your product out of the freezer and let it sit for maybe 20 minutes on your counter or put some warm water around your container of course with the lid on and do that cuz that your freezer is just too hard but ninja is pretty good at helping people I have not had a problem with my original machine and it's over 2 years old and I expect years of use with the one I have now also I think Walmart has some of the empty containers for for I think it was $17. Good luck have fun and there are so many great recipes especially for those that are diabetics or doing low carb just some really

A daily staple for smoothie bowls and lactose-free

The Ninja CREAMi is one of the most used appliances in my kitchen. I use it almost daily for smoothie bowls, and it’s been a game changer for making custom ice cream at home. Being able to make completely lactose-free ice cream in so many varieties is huge, especially since that’s usually very hard to find with good texture. What really sets it apart is how creamy and smooth everything turns out from a fully frozen base. Smoothie bowls come out thick and spoonable, and the ice cream settings give a true ice-cream texture, not icy or grainy. I also love the flexibility — from healthier options to more indulgent treats, it handles everything well. It’s easy to use once you get the hang of freezing the base ahead of time, and the results are consistently worth it. If you like smoothie bowls or need dairy-free or lactose-free frozen desserts, this machine is absolutely worth it.

Poorest Design Ever to SAFELY CLEAN

This is the single POOREST DESIGN APPLIANCE EVER. ANYBODY who has one, after you've used it a couple times, shine a flashlight into the bottom side of the lid, I can guaranty there will ice cream, mix ins and MOLD inside. It is 95% IMPOSSIBLE to clean out. The 3 little springs that operate the blade release mechanism will be covered and filled with food material and mold. When I contacted Ninja, their answer was, and I quote, " There is not a Cleaning Solution Fix for this. We appreciate your input and comments and will pass them on for future consideration. YouTube is full of videos concerning this issue. The next newest version, Ninja Addressed this issue in the lid. Instead of the Plastic being transparent, the plastic is now BLACK and non transparent. I washed/rinsed and used a Industrial Kitchen Cleaner for 45 minutes and could not get the food matter and mold out of the inside of the lid. And it was rinsed after every use as per the User Manual. Your first clue that it isn't clean, You can smell it.

Broken Gears

Broke after about 8 uses ... I always follow the instruction manual and have the container filled at or below the "max fill" line. Tonight, the machine made a crazy noise at the beginning of the spin cycle and then everything seemed OK. But when I was eating the ice cream, I noticed little flecks of something in it. Upon closer inspection, I realized it was TINY SHARDS OF METAL. I cannot believe I had at least 3 bites before realizing it and am pretty sure I ate specs of metal. When I went to look at the machine, I saw that the blade on the lid had tread that was partially shaved down and a huge cut into the base. I don't have the slightest clue how bits from that made it into the ice cream since the gears are on the outside of the lid. I am mortified. I just registered the product and will be praying that their warranty will cover it. With only 8 uses, at $177 with tax, we're looking at $22 per pint NOT including ingredients.

Amazing product if you don't mind the wait

I really like this machine. I use Nature Valley chocolate cookies to substitute Oreos for a better quality cookies and cream ice cream. It is super simple to use. It has so many different variations of ice cream. You can make anything from sorbet to soft serve to a thicker, scoopable ice cream. And the possibilities are really endless with what you can make. My only catch with this is the fact that you have to fill the containers, put them in the freezer for 24 to 48 hours, then you can make your ice cream. Even then, the containers are so small that it doesn't make very much. If you don't freeze at least six containers at a time, it is not enough for a full family to eat ice cream, and you'll be waiting days for everybody to be disappointed, only getting a bite or two..
